Indiana Law & Local Experience
Civil Mediation Under Indiana Law
Indiana courts encourage and often order alternative dispute resolution before a civil case reaches trial. Mediation is the most widely used option, conducted by a neutral mediator who has no authority to impose a decision on either party.
Discussions at mediation are confidential and generally cannot be used later at trial, which is what makes candid negotiation possible. Once the parties sign a settlement agreement, it becomes an enforceable contract.
